Saints Row The Third Retrospective
Me and my wife just replayed the entire series together, and what stuck out to me the most, was how abysmally bad SR3 is. I'm gonna pick it apart, mostly just to get my own thoughts out, but also to see if anyone feels the same about this overrated mess.
And that's just what it is, right? Overrated. SR fans hold it up as some kind of wonderful compromise between 2 and 4, when it's really the worst of both, a game that does nothing uniquely well. It's characters are just ugly caricatures of the 2010's, it's story is nonsensical and borderline non-existent, and it's open world is, no contest, the most lifeless, boring, personality-less, dead thing I've ever seen. The whole game is a hollow vehicle for the dev's cornball GenX chungus humor and very little else besides.
I'm not bound to nostalgia by any means, but playing it right after 2, it's impossible not to compare. Impossible not to notice just how much less there is to do in 3. The effort from the devs is just not here. The activities are incredibly dull and frustrating, the customization is half what it was, the interiors and map variety are gone, the illusion of freedom in a big sandbox is lost. Not to mention, it's buggy as all hell, especially in co-op.
What surprised me though, is how even 4 was a step up. 4 at least KNOWS what it is. It gives you some fun stuff to fool around with, and despite how absurd it is, actually takes its premise and characters seriously at times. Weirdly, it treats the OG games with much more reverence than their direct sequel did. It also at least remembers to be a fun game first, rather than JUST a parody, which was such a relief after toiling through 3.
I couldn't believe how much time and, I guess, nostalgia had warped my perspective of SR3. Couldn't believe what a chore it was. It's a crass, gray, ugly dick joke wrapped up like a video game. It peaks in the first hour and then nosedives off a cliff, never to recover. What a sad hunk of shit. Should've turned it off as soon as "Power" wrapped up.

General Could Saints Row work as a party-based RPG?
I had a thought this week about the franchise and if it were to be revived, what would it look like? Then I thought about how I've been into companion, choice-based RPGs lately and I wondered if Saints Row could pull it off. I use Saints Row specifically, because in today's landscape far as this subgenre, you're either in space (Mass Effect, Outer Worlds) or in a medieval fantasy setting (Dragon Age, Baldur's Gate 3). What about an RPG in a modern, urban setting? I feel like Saints Row already had the DNA to pull this off, as you would have companions like Shaundi and Pierce assist you in battle, you'd level up, you'd buy bigger and better weapons as you go along in the campaign etc. but what about going further and giving the player choices that actually affected the story?
One big criticism of today's RPG's is that they don't let you be truly evil and you don't get to experience the consequences of your choices. Well, in Saints Row, you're a gangster, you're not Mr./Ms. Goody Two Shoes to being with, so "bad" choices would be plentiful in a game like this.
If you wanted to add in romance and crew members liking/disliking you for your actions that's fine too.
It would also have to be in a serious tone. No bright colors or quirky characters. Gangs and organized crime has always been the dark underbelly of society and it needs to be presented as such.
Overall, I just wanted to bring forth a discussion piece about how to evolve the series. I see a franchise like God of War pivot to a more mature, narrative based game and I wonder if Saints Row could one day get that treatment.
